Cardiff, the capital of Wales, is a large and popular city among the tourists. Cardiff is the centre of Welsh culture, sports, commerce, local Welsh media and the Assembly government.

Cardiff is built on a marshland on a bed of Triassic stones. The marshland stretches from Chepstow to the Ely estuary, which serves as a natural boundary between Cardiff and the Vale of Glamorgan. Cardiff's landscape is quite flat because of the Triassic marshlands. This along with its close proximity and easy access to the coal fields of the south Wales valleys has led to it being the world's largest coal port.

A small town in the early 19th century, Cardiff came into prominence as a major port for coal transportation with the arrival of industry in the Welsh region. Cardiff was first given the status of a city in 1905; it then went on to become the capital of Wales in 1955. Cardiff is now part of the Euro cities network of the largest European cities. It is also a major transport hub in Wales and is a major focus for many rail routes and Ariel connections.

Due to the beautiful landscape and healthy transport system Cardiff has become a major tourist destination. It is because of this that many retail shops and chains have sprung up. It is now one of the top ten retail destinations in the United Kingdom. Though the shops are quite widespread in Cardiff, two streets, namely; Queen Street and St Mary Street are the most popular amongst the shoppers. There are also several shopping arcades to pull the crowd amongst which three of them deserve a mention: St David's Centre, Queen's Arcade and the Capitol Centre.

Cardiff has been able to maintain a balance between materialism and naturalism to a great extent. It is therefore quite common to see huge expanses of plush green lands all over the city along with towering buildings and shopping arcades. The lake at Roath Park, including the lighthouse that was erected in the memory of Scott Cardiff is known for its extensive parkland, with parks and other such green areas covering around 10% of the city's total area. Cardiff's main park, known as Bute Park stretches northwards from one of the shopping streets in Cardiff, if combined with the adjacent Llandaff Fields and the Pontcanna Fields it produces a huge open space skirting the river Taff.
